What to Pack

Three products cover most trips: beard shampoo, beard oil, and a brush. Wash the beard, press a few drops of oil through it while it is still damp, brush it into place — that is the whole routine, and it takes about five minutes. Add balm if you want hold, and a small comb if you are keeping a mustache in line. The same load-out works for a gym locker as it does for a hotel sink.
